World of Warcraft has a special Feast of Winter Veil gift for Hunters this year in the form of the Dreaming Festive Reindeer, a secret pet that can only be tamed during the holiday. This Hunter surprise, along with the Feast of Winter Veil in-game event, is available in World of Warcraft now through January 5th.

Feast of the Winter Veil in World of Warcraft is the in-game equivalent of the Christmas holiday. Every year, Blizzard brings back the event for a few weeks and often adds brand new surprises, like the Winter Veil Armor customization for the Mount Highland Drake from last year.

Now the feast of the winter veil is back and this year World of Warcraft added something special especially for Hunters. Fans who venture to the Old Hillsbrad foothills during the event, located in the Escape from Durnholde Keep dungeon in the Caverns of Time, will find the Dreaming Festive Reindeer in the woods, but only if they are wearing or transmog the full Winter Veil outfit or using disposable winter veil suit. Hunters who do so will be able to tame both normal reindeer and rarer red-nosed versions for themselves, after which they can be used as permanent Tenacity pets throughout the year.

Dreaming Festive Reindeer isn't the only new addition to Winter Veil this year. The Abominable Greench's daily encounter has a new mechanic where it creates gifts that can be opened during battle, and the Stolen Present obtained as loot from its defeat may contain a miniature animal version of the boss named Grunch. What's more, festive vendors in Orgrimmar and Ironforge are selling new red and green Winter Veil transmog outfits for a small amount of gold, giving Hunters an easy way to dress up their Dreaming Festive Reindeer spawns.

Fans hoping to encounter the Greench can easily reach him on the festive sleigh rides from Father Winter's Helper from Dornogal to Orgrimmar or Ironforge and then to the Hillsbrad Foothills.
